Corded vs. Cordless: Which Should You Buy?
Before searching listings for electrical power tools for sale, purchasers must choose which source of power Best Prices On Power Tools fits their workflow.
- Corded Tools: These plug straight into a standard electrical outlet. They offer endless run-time and generally provide consistent, high power output without the risk of battery deterioration. They are perfect for stationary workshop tools (like table saws) or durable demolition work.
- Cordless Tools: Powered by rechargeable batteries, these tools supply unrivaled mobility and freedom of movement. Modern brushless motors and advanced battery chemistry indicate today's cordless tools typically rival-- and in some cases exceed-- the performance of their corded predecessors.

When looking at electric power tools for sale, impulse buying can result in wasted money. To make sure complete satisfaction, purchasers need to assess a number of vital aspects:
- Platform Compatibility: If buying cordless tools, it is smart to stick to a single maker (e.g., DeWalt, Milwaukee, Makita, or Bosch). This allows batteries and chargers to be interchangeable throughout different tools, saving significant money over time.
- Motor Type (Brushed vs. Brushless): Brushless motors are typically more efficient, create less heat, last longer, and supply more power than conventional brushed motors. Though they normally cost more, they represent a much better long-lasting financial investment.
- Ergonomics and Weight: A Tool Shop Near Me that feels too heavy or uncomfortable can trigger fast fatigue. Always examine the weight distribution and handle grip, particularly for tools used overhead or for extended durations.
- Service Warranty and Customer Support: Reputable brands back up their items. Try to find tools that offer a multi-year guarantee or a money-back assurance.

What does "tool-only" imply when looking for electric tools?
"Tool-only" (or bare tool) indicates the purchase consists of the power tool itself, however does not include a battery or a charger. This option is designed for purchasers who are currently bought a particular brand name's battery environment.
How can I make my power tool batteries last longer?
To maximize battery life-span, prevent storing them in severe temperature levels (like a freezing garage or a hot car in summer season). Furthermore, attempt not to drain pipes lithium-ion batteries entirely before charging them.
Is it safe to purchase pre-owned power tools?
Buying utilized can conserve money, however it brings dangers. Constantly check the tool before acquiring if possible, look for frayed cords or damaged real estates, and keep in mind that producer guarantees usually do not move to pre-owned buyers.
